Bike Assembly in Conroe, TX
Bike assembly services involve putting together new bicycles or repairing existing ones to ensure they are safe and ready for riding. This service typically covers assembling bikes purchased from stores or online retailers, including road bikes, mountain bikes, children's bikes, and specialty cycles. Homeowners often request bike assembly when they want their new bikes ready to ride without the hassle of figuring out instructions or dealing with small parts, or when repairs are needed to reassemble a bike after maintenance or parts replacement.
Property owners should consider the type of bike, the complexity of the assembly, and any specific requirements before requesting this service. It's helpful to know if the bike includes multiple parts or accessories, such as gears, brakes, or suspension components, and whether the assembly involves installing additional accessories like racks or lights. Clarifying these details can help ensure the service provider understands the scope of work and provides a safe, properly assembled bicycle ready for use.

Bike Assembly Questions
What types of bikes can be assembled? Bicycle assembly services typically handle a variety of bikes, including road bikes, mountain bikes, hybrids, and children's bikes.
Is bike assembly suitable for new or used bikes? The service is suitable for both new bikes straight from the store and used bikes that need reassembly or repairs.
What should property owners prepare before assembly? It’s helpful to have all the bike parts and tools available, and to clear space for the assembly process.
Does bike assembly include adjustments and tuning? Yes, the service often includes basic adjustments, such as aligning the gears and brakes, for optimal performance.
